Full-size patterns and step-by-step instructions are provided for 20 working wooden toy ornaments. From tugboats and tractors to windmills and wagons, these nostalgic moving toys make great Christmas ornaments as well as keepsake gifts for family and friends. And these simple projects don't take a lot of time, wood or tools to make. They’re a great way to reuse and repurpose scrap wood, and require only minimal painting. All you need is a scroll saw, a drill and some glue to create memorable family heirlooms. You can create them assembly-line style and fill a tree—or make a lot of gifts—with just an afternoon’s work.
